Key Concepts Covered
➡️ Understanding motion graphs – How position–time and velocity–time graphs visualize object movement
➡️ Slope analysis – Interpreting slope as speed or acceleration in various graph types
➡️ Displacement and area under graphs – Connecting the area under velocity–time graphs to total displacement
